声音传感器简介

  声音传感器的作用相当于一个话筒(麦克风)。它用来接收声波,显示声音的振动图像,但不能对噪声的强度进行测量。
  该传感器内置一个对声音敏感的电容式驻极体话筒。声波使话筒内的驻极体薄膜振动,导致电容的变化,而产生与之对应变化的微小电压。这一电压随后被转化成0-5V的电压,经过A/D转换被数据采集器接受,并传送给主板。
 &emsp由麦克风,电压比较器IC(LM393),电位器,晶体管,LED和一些其他无源元件(电阻器和电容器)组成。

使用说明:

  1.声音模块对环境声音强度最敏感,一般用来检测周围环境的声音强度
  2.在环境声音强度达不到设定阈值时,模块DO口输出高电平
   当外界环境声音强度超过设定阈值时,模块DO输出低电平
  3.输出DO可与单片机直接相连,通过单片机来检测高低电平,由此来检测环境的声音,可直接制动继电器模块,组成声控开关。
  4.可通过电位器调节灵敏度。
  5.有电源指示灯,比较器输出有指示灯。
  6.只能识别声音的有无(根据震动原理)不能识别声音的大小或者特定频率的声音。
  输出形式 数字开关量输出(0和1高低电平)

声音传感器模块的使用

实验一:声音模块的读取

项目要求:

  观察说话和没说话,声音模块的高低电平的输入(数字引脚)

电路搭建

参考程序

int  syPin = 3;
void setup(){pinMode(syPin,INPUT); Serial.begin(9600);
}
void loop() {int syValue =digitalRead(syPin);Serial.print("syValue =");Serial.println(syValue);delay(200);
}

实验现象

  当没有声音时,输入的是高电平(数字1)。
  当有声音时,输入的是低电平(数字0)。
注意 :要调节好模块的灵敏度,不说话时候,信号指示灯灭,说话时候,信号指示灯亮。

原理图


Arduino Uno 实验14——声音传感器相关推荐

  1. Arduino笔记实验(初级阶段)—火焰传感器+有源蜂鸣器实验

    Arduino笔记实验(初级阶段)-火焰传感器+有源蜂鸣器实验 文章目录 Arduino笔记实验(初级阶段)-火焰传感器+有源蜂鸣器实验 前言 一.电路图 二.火焰传感器(4引脚)-有源蜂鸣器 代码 ...

  2. Arduino Uno 使用TCS3200D颜色传感器 分辨颜色

    欢迎关注「凌顺实验室」微信公众号 TCS3200颜色传感器 实验效果 把色纸放在传感器2CM左右高的地方, 可以检测到该物体的RGB值, 然后我们通过画板可以检验出颜色是否正确 在实际环境中,自然光, ...

  3. Arduino UNO测试BME680环境传感器

    原文链接:https://www.yourcee.com/newsinfo/2929148.html BME680简介 BME680是一个四合一数字环境检测传感器,可以测量所处周围环境的温度.湿度.气 ...

  4. Arduino Uno PM2.5粉尘传感器(GP2Y1010AU0F) 看看家里的空气质量

    欢迎关注「凌顺实验室」微信公众号 这次用到的这个模块,是SHARP GP2Y10(粉尘传感器,其实我在怀疑是否也叫PM2.5) 买到手的时候,除了传感器还有随附的一个150欧姆的电阻和一个220uf的 ...

  5. 如何用Arduino UNO和DS18B20防水传感器制作一个温度计

    使用Arduino UNO和DS18B20防水温度传感器自制温度计! 在本篇文章中,我们将使用Arduino UNO开发板和DS18B20温度传感器来制作温度计.当高精度应用需要良好的响应能力时,DS ...

  6. Arduino Uno 实验15——MQ-135 气体传感器模块

    MQ-135 气体传感器模块简介(空气质量检测 有害气体检测)   MQ135气体传感器所使用的气敏材料是在清洁空气中电导率较低的二氧化锡(SnO2).当传感器所处环境中存在污染气体时,传感器的电导率 ...

  7. Arduino Uno 实验11——MQ-3酒精乙醇传感器模块

    MQ-3酒精乙醇传感器模块简介   MQ-3气体传感器所使用的气敏材料是在清洁空气中电导率较低的二氧化锡(Sn02).当传感器所处环境中存在酒精蒸汽时,传感器的电导率随空气中酒精气体浓度的增加而增大. ...

  8. Arduino Uno 实验8——HC-SR04 超声波测距模块

    HC-SR04 超声波测距模块简介   由于超声波指向性强,能量消耗缓慢,在介质中传播的距离较远,因而超声波经常用于距离的测量,如测距仪和物位测量仪等都可以通过超声波来实现.   HC-SR04超声波 ...

  9. 第四篇、基于Arduino uno,获取土壤湿度传感器的原始值和含水量——结果导向

    0.结果 说明:先来看看串口调试助手显示的结果,第一个值是原始的模拟电压值,第二个值是含水量,如果是你想要的,可以接着往下看. 1.外观 说明:虽然土壤湿度传感器形态各异,但是原理和代码都是适用的. ...

最新文章

  1. 2022-2028年中国EBA树脂(乙烯丙烯酸丁酯)产业竞争现状及发展前景规划报告
  2. C++及Windows异常处理(try,catch; __try,__finally; __try, __except)——一道笔试题引起的探究
  3. 实景三维系列4 | 为什么需要单体化
  4. c++服务器开发学习--02--MySQL,Redis,ASIO,iocp,TrinityCore代码结构,c++对象模型
  5. Nand分区及nand erase简解
  6. Linux学习笔记(十五)用户和用户组
  7. [设计模式]观察者模式
  8. powershell 中的pause
  9. [html] history和hash两种路由方式的最大区别是什么?
  10. 阿里巴巴2013年实习生笔试题A
  11. simpla是基于laravel5的php,一个基于laravel5.1的后台
  12. POJ NOI MATH-7833 幂的末尾
  13. nodejs redis 发布订阅_Redis 发布订阅,小功能大用处,真没那么废材
  14. go语言介绍及应用场景分析
  15. 你的PCB地线走的对吗?为什么要有主地?
  16. 使用Hbuilder搭建MUI框架
  17. ong拼音汉字_汉语拼音中ong怎么读
  18. [CISCN2019 华东南赛区]Web11
  19. 淘宝店适合什么样引流方法?淘宝店应该如何引流?
  20. c++入门中,一道题展开的东西……继承与派生,多态和重载

热门文章

  1. 滴滴夜莺02-自定义推送数据
  2. Uip WebServer 实现
  3. 网络安全之暴露面、攻击面、脆弱性
  4. java什么是类型擦除_Java 泛型,你了解类型擦除吗?
  5. 0324的学习笔记----里面最重要的就是一个tom猫的动画,和涉及到的内存问题(创建imageview的两种方式,imagenamed就会形成缓存,占用很多内
  6. java xml格式验证_Java中对XML文件的校验
  7. 学讲普通话水平测试软件,普通话智能学习软件
  8. C语言编程答案保留三位小数,如何用c语言求倒数,保留3位有效数字
  9. 当初的愿望实现了吗?
  10. Python练习-2